What are the tracing practice sheets?

Choose the Practice layout, or switch Letters to "Trace (dashed)". Practice sheets show the name once in solid outline, then in dashed letters over handwriting guidelines so kids can trace it several times.

Will the SVG work with my Cricut or Silhouette?

Yes. When you download an SVG or PNG, the letters are converted into real vector outlines rather than live text, so they look the same in cutting and design software — no fonts to install.

What are the best print settings?

Print at 100% scale (not "fit to page") on plain Letter or A4 paper. For crayons and markers, the Medium or Thick line weight is easiest for small hands to stay inside.
